Day 4 Petrified Forest
Discover the Vingerklip, a rock finger that is 35
metres high after being subjected to centuries
of erosion. Visit the Petrified Forest, composed
of gigantic tree trunks, transported by floods
and covered in mud. In time they turned to
stone and some are 30 metres long. Continue
on to the Twyfelfontein area; a very vulnerable
and delicate ecosystem, renowned for some of
the best examples of Bushman paintings and
rock engravings in southern Africa. Interesting
rock formations and the remainder of prehistoric volcanic action can be seen among
the most prominent geographic features.

Day 8 Sossusvlei
Discover Dead Vlei (Dried-up Lake), a
spectacle to marvel at where only a few dead
trees remain, surrounded by dunes. Visit
Sossusvlei which boasts the highest dunes in
the world (higher than 300 metres) in the
oldest desert on the planet, the Namib. A
4WD will transfer you over the last 5kms to
Sossusvlei. After lunch discover the Sesriem
Canyon, formed by the Tsauchab river which
has eroded a gorge some 50 metres deep.
